If you are not satisfied with your phone company's response, contact your state government or the Federal Communications Commission (FCC). Contact your state consumer protection office for help resolving a phone company complaint.

Complaints can be filed online at fcc/complaints. Filing online is the quickest and most effective way to file a complaint. Other options for filing a complaint with the FCC include: Phone: 1-888-CALL-FCC (1-888-225-5322); ASL Video Call: 1-844-432-2275.
NYC311 can provide you access to non-emergency City services and information about City government programs. NYC311 can help with a broad range of services, including things like homeless person assistance, pothole repair, or help understanding a property tax bill.
Online claim in your T-Mobile Account Log in to your T-Mobile account using a web browser. Select Account and choose the line you're filing a claim on. Select File a claim or File damage claim or Report lost or stolen. Once you confirm the selection, you'll be redirected to the claims website at mytmoclaim.
If your city has a 311 service, you can call to report issues like abandoned vehicles, noise complaints, and graffiti. By adding a second channel for citizens to report problems, 911 operators are freer to address emergencies. While it isn't available nationally, many metro areas have a 311 system in place.
311 is available online, by texting 311-692, or by calling 3-1-1 from within the City or 212-NEW-YORK outside the five boroughs. TTY service is also available by dialing 212-504-4115.
